NAME

Net::Amazon::Config - Manage Amazon Web Services credentials

SYNOPSIS

Example

     use Net::Amazon::Config;
 
     # default location and profile
     my $profile = Net::Amazon::Config->new->get_profile;
 
     # use access key ID and secret access key with S3 
     use Net::Amazon::S3;
     my $s3 = Net::Amazon::S3->new(
       aws_access_key_id     => $profile->access_key_id,
       aws_secret_access_key => $profile->secret_access_key,
     );

Config Format

   default = johndoe
   [johndoe]
   access_key_id = XX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XX
   secret_access_key = XX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XX
   certificate_file = my-cert.pem
   private_key_file = my-key.pem
   ec2_keypair_name = my-ec2-keypair
   ec2_keypair_file = ec2-private-key.pem
   aws_account_id = 0123-4567-8901
   canonical_user_id = <64-character string>

DESCRIPTION

This module lets you keep Amazon Web Services credentials in a configuration file for use with different tools that need them.

USAGE

new()

   my $config = Net::Amazon::Config->new( %params );

Valid %params entries include:

  • config_dir -- directory containing the config file (and the default location for other files named in the config file). Defaults to $HOME/.amazon

  • config_file -- defaults to profiles.conf

Returns an object or undef if no config file can be found.

config_path()

   my $path = $config->config_path;

Returns the absolute path to the configuration file.

get_profile()

   my $profile = $config->get_profile( $name );

If $name is omitted or undefined, returns the profile named in the top-level key default in the config file. If the profile does not exist, get profile returns undef or an empty list.

ENVIRONMENT

  • NET_AMAZON_CONFIG -- absolute path to config file or file name relative to the configuration directory

  • NET_AMAZON_CONFIG_DIR -- configuration directory
